Enumeration of Capture Devices


If you are looking for a particular kind of device, want to offer the user a choice of devices, or need to work with two or more devices, you must enumerate the devices available on the system. For an application that is just going to capture sounds through the user's preferred capture device, you don't need to enumerate the available devices. For more information, see Creating the Capture Object.

Enumeration serves three purposes.

To enumerate devices, first create a capture device using CaptureDevicesCollection.


Send comments about this topic to Microsoft. © Microsoft Corporation. All rights reserved.

Feedback? Please provide us with your comments on this topic.
For more help, visit the DirectX Developer Center